RACING NEWS: REEBOK BACKS OUT OF IRL TITLE SPONSORSHIP

          Reebok "has decided not to become the series sponsor"
     of the IRL, sponsoring an IRL car instead, according to
     Bruce Martin of NATIONAL SPEED SPORT NEWS.  Martin reports
     that IRL officials "did not want its series sponsor to also
     be a primary sponsor of a car."  While IRL execs "refused to
     discuss Reebok," team owners believed a deal would have been
     worth "as much as" $7M to the series (NSSN, 1/7 issue).
          RACING NOTES: NSSN reports more "factoids" from CART's
     IPO prospectus.  CART CEO Andrew Craig's salary, including
     bonuses, was $573,426 in '96.  From '98-2000 his base
     salaries will be $500,000, $550,000 and $600,000 (NSSN, 1/7
     issue)....Former IMS exec Bill Donaldson's Premier
     Management Group has taken over the day-to-day operations of
     the Las Vegas Motor Speedway (LAS VEGAS SUN, 1/15).
